Chalfont-New Britain Township Joint Sewer Authority Doylestown, PA WWTP Phase 2 Improvements
General Notice
Chalfont-New Britain Township Joint Sewage Authority (Owner) is requesting Bids for the construction of the following Project:
Wastewater Treatment Plant Phase 2 ImprovementsBids for the construction of the Project will be received via PennBID.com, until 1:00pm on March 31, 2026 (local time). At that time the Bids received will be opened and posted online via PennBid.
The Project includes the following Work:
Phased removal of the surface aerators, IMLR pumps, valves, piping, RAS pumps, and related electrical and control equipment.
Phased installation of blowers, diffused aeration system, submersible mixers, RAS pumps, IMLR pumps, valves, piping, related structural modifications, electrical, and controls equipment.
Installation of course bubble diffusers and related piping, valves, instrumentation, and appurtenances for aerobic digester.

Statutory Requirements.Bidders must comply with all State antibid-rigging regulations pertaining to work associated with this project, and will be required to submit an executed non-collusion affidavit with the bid.
Bidders should refer to provisions of federal and state statutes, rules and regulations dealing with the prevention of environmental pollution and preservation of public natural resources that affect the project, pursuant to Act No. 247 of the General Assembly of the Commonwealth of Pennsylvania, approved October 26, 1972.
This Project falls under The Commonwealth of Pennsylvania enacted Act 127 of 2012, known as the Public Works Employment Verification Act ('the Act') which requires all public work contractors and subcontractors to utilize the Federal Government's E-Verify system to ensure that all employees performing work on public work projects are authorized to work in the United States. All Bidders are required to submit a Public Works Employment Verification Form as a precondition for the Contract Award.
The estimated cost for each Contract of this project is greater than Twenty-five Thousand Dollars ($25,000) and the Pennsylvania Prevailing Wage Act shall apply.
All bids shall be irrevocable for 60 days after the bid opening date as provided by the Act of November 26, 1978 (P.L. 1309, No. 317), as amended by the Act of December 12, 1994 (P.L. 1042, No. 142).
